  • The Large Hadron Collider | CERN
    The Large Hadron Collider (LHC) is the world’s largest and most powerful particle accelerator that pushes protons or ions to near the speed of light It first started up on 10 September 2008, and remains the latest addition to CERN’s accelerator complex
  • Accelerators - CERN
    An accelerator propels charged particles, such as protons or electrons, at high speeds, close to the speed of light They are then smashed either onto a target or against other particles circulating in the opposite direction
  • How an accelerator works - CERN
    An accelerator comes either in the form of a ring (a circular accelerator), where a beam of particles travels repeatedly round a loop, or in a straight line (a linear accelerator), where the particle beam travels from one end to the other
  • The accelerator complex | CERN
    The accelerator complex at CERN is a succession of machines that accelerate particles to increasingly higher energies Each machine boosts the energy of a beam of particles before injecting it into the next machine in the sequence
  • The Future Circular Collider | CERN
    The Future Circular Collider (FCC) study is developing designs for higher performance particle colliders that could follow on from the Large Hadron Collider (LHC) once it reaches the end of its High-Luminosity phase
  • Facts and figures about the LHC - CERN
    How was the LHC designed? Scientists started thinking about the LHC in the early 1980s, when the previous accelerator, the LEP, was not yet running In December 1994, CERN Council voted to approve the construction of the LHC and in October 1995, the LHC technical design report was published
  • About CERN
    The instruments used at CERN are purpose-built particle accelerators and detectors Accelerators boost beams of particles to high energies before the beams are made to collide with each other or with stationary targets
  • The Proton Synchrotron - CERN
    The Proton Synchrotron (PS) is a key component in CERN’s accelerator complex, where it usually accelerates either protons delivered by the Proton Synchrotron Booster or heavy ions from the Low Energy Ion Ring (LEIR)
